Strawberries
British strawberries in June are delicious. They become ripe in June and stay in season until August. Lots of places allow you to pick your own or look out for some great offers in the supermarket. Strawberries can be used in salads, cakes, with cream or enjoyed on their own as a snack.
Peas
It is quite rare for people to use fresh peas as frozen peas are such a great option. However at this time of year fresh peas grown in the garden are delicious. Peas are a really popular vegetable and can be added to a variety of dishes or served as an accompaniment to a main meal.
Beetroot
This is a great vegetable for adding colour and a strong flavour to a salad. When you are buying fresh beetroot you should make sure that the skin has not been damaged and look for beetroots smaller than 6cm in diameter. Unlike some other vegetables you can keep uncooked beetroot for over a week in the fridge.
Peaches
Peaches that are picked at their best can't be beaten and they are fantastic in the summer. They are full of Vitamin C and are a good source of fibre. Once a peach has been picked from the tree it gets softer and much juicier but the flavour actually develops whilst on the tree so they shouldn't be picked too early. Peaches are best served raw but they can be slightly cooked for some dishes
